403Webshell
Server IP : 162.144.4.212  /  Your IP : 216.73.216.108
Web Server : Apache
System : Linux gator2125.hostgator.com 5.14.0-162.23.1.9991722448259.nf.el9.x86_64 #1 SMP PREEMPT_DYNAMIC Wed Jul 31 18:11:45 UTC 2024 x86_64
User : cozeellc ( 2980)
PHP Version : 8.3.31
Disable Function : NONE
MySQL : OFF |  cURL : ON |  WGET : ON |  Perl : ON |  Python : OFF |  Sudo : ON |  Pkexec : ON
Directory :  /usr/lib/python3.9/site-packages/oci/devops/models/__pycache__/

Upload File :
current_dir [ Writeable] document_root [ Writeable]

 

Command :


[ Back ]     

Current File : /usr/lib/python3.9/site-packages/oci/devops/models/__pycache__/diff_line_details.cpython-39.pyc
a

���f�@s8ddlmZmZmZddlmZeGdd�de��ZdS)�)�formatted_flat_dict�
NONE_SENTINEL�#value_allowed_none_or_none_sentinel)�init_model_state_from_kwargsc@s�eZdZdZdZdZdZdZdd�Ze	dd	��Z
e
jd
d	��Z
e	dd��Zejd
d��Ze	dd��Z
e
jdd��Z
e	dd��Zejdd��Zdd�Zdd�Zdd�ZdS)�DiffLineDetailsz5
    Details about a line within the difference.
    �BASE�TARGET�MARKER�NONEcKs<ddddd�|_ddddd�|_d|_d|_d|_d|_dS)	a�
        Initializes a new DiffLineDetails object with values from keyword arguments.
        The following keyword arguments are supported (corresponding to the getters/setters of this class):

        :param base_line:
            The value to assign to the base_line property of this DiffLineDetails.
        :type base_line: int

        :param target_line:
            The value to assign to the target_line property of this DiffLineDetails.
        :type target_line: int

        :param line_content:
            The value to assign to the line_content property of this DiffLineDetails.
        :type line_content: str

        :param conflict_marker:
            The value to assign to the conflict_marker property of this DiffLineDetails.
            Allowed values for this property are: "BASE", "TARGET", "MARKER", "NONE", 'UNKNOWN_ENUM_VALUE'.
            Any unrecognized values returned by a service will be mapped to 'UNKNOWN_ENUM_VALUE'.
        :type conflict_marker: str

        �int�str)�	base_line�target_line�line_content�conflict_markerZbaseLineZ
targetLineZlineContentZconflictMarkerN)Z
swagger_typesZ
attribute_map�
_base_line�_target_line�
_line_content�_conflict_marker)�self�kwargs�r�G/usr/lib/python3.9/site-packages/oci/devops/models/diff_line_details.py�__init__"s��zDiffLineDetails.__init__cCs|jS)z�
        Gets the base_line of this DiffLineDetails.
        The number of a line in the base version.


        :return: The base_line of this DiffLineDetails.
        :rtype: int
        �r�rrrrr
Ms
zDiffLineDetails.base_linecCs
||_dS)z�
        Sets the base_line of this DiffLineDetails.
        The number of a line in the base version.


        :param base_line: The base_line of this DiffLineDetails.
        :type: int
        Nr)rr
rrrr
Ys
cCs|jS)z�
        Gets the target_line of this DiffLineDetails.
        The number of a line in the target version.


        :return: The target_line of this DiffLineDetails.
        :rtype: int
        �rrrrrres
zDiffLineDetails.target_linecCs
||_dS)z�
        Sets the target_line of this DiffLineDetails.
        The number of a line in the target version.


        :param target_line: The target_line of this DiffLineDetails.
        :type: int
        Nr)rrrrrrqs
cCs|jS)z�
        Gets the line_content of this DiffLineDetails.
        The contents of a line.


        :return: The line_content of this DiffLineDetails.
        :rtype: str
        �rrrrrr}s
zDiffLineDetails.line_contentcCs
||_dS)z�
        Sets the line_content of this DiffLineDetails.
        The contents of a line.


        :param line_content: The line_content of this DiffLineDetails.
        :type: str
        Nr)rrrrrr�s
cCs|jS)a1
        Gets the conflict_marker of this DiffLineDetails.
        Indicates whether a line in a conflicted section of the difference is from the base version, the target version, or if its just a marker indicating the beginning, middle, or end of a conflicted section.

        Allowed values for this property are: "BASE", "TARGET", "MARKER", "NONE", 'UNKNOWN_ENUM_VALUE'.
        Any unrecognized values returned by a service will be mapped to 'UNKNOWN_ENUM_VALUE'.


        :return: The conflict_marker of this DiffLineDetails.
        :rtype: str
        )rrrrrr�s
zDiffLineDetails.conflict_markercCs gd�}t||�sd}||_dS)ax
        Sets the conflict_marker of this DiffLineDetails.
        Indicates whether a line in a conflicted section of the difference is from the base version, the target version, or if its just a marker indicating the beginning, middle, or end of a conflicted section.


        :param conflict_marker: The conflict_marker of this DiffLineDetails.
        :type: str
        )rrr	r
ZUNKNOWN_ENUM_VALUEN)rr)rrZallowed_valuesrrrr�s

cCst|�S�N)rrrrr�__repr__�szDiffLineDetails.__repr__cCs|durdS|j|jkS)NF)�__dict__�r�otherrrr�__eq__�szDiffLineDetails.__eq__cCs
||kSrrr!rrr�__ne__�szDiffLineDetails.__ne__N)�__name__�
__module__�__qualname__�__doc__ZCONFLICT_MARKER_BASEZCONFLICT_MARKER_TARGETZCONFLICT_MARKER_MARKERZCONFLICT_MARKER_NONEr�propertyr
�setterrrrrr#r$rrrrrs2+







rN)Zoci.utilrrrZoci.decoratorsr�objectrrrrr�<module>s

Youez - 2016 - github.com/yon3zu
LinuXploit